Customer and Trading Manager - Convenience

What you’ll be doing:

  • Working closely with a small team of managers to make sure the store runs like clockwork every day. 
  • Taking responsibility for the day to running of the store, often being the only manager in with accountability for the full shop. 
  • Work alongside a team to complete all tasks, ensuring our customers are served efficiently and safely. 
  • People management is also big part of the role, managing performance and capability, conducting disciplinaries and ensuring scheduling and pay are accurate. 
  • Where we have close knit networks of convenience stores it may mean that you need to help another store now and then.

Essential Criteria:

  • A track record of delivering brilliant customer service and coaching colleagues to do the same.
  • Experience of leading a team in a fast-paced, customer-facing environment — you’ve motivated others, driven performance, and kept operations running smoothly.
  • Operational leadership skills  — you’ve taken responsibility for store operations in the absence of more senior managers.
  • Demonstrated success in meeting or exceeding KPIs — whether it’s sales, availability, customer satisfaction or colleague engagement, you’ve made a measurable impact.
  • Has managed employee relations issues, including performance and absence management.
